Ultimate Responsive Image Slider features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    The Ultimate Responsive Image Slider offers an easy-to-use interface, allowing even beginners to create responsive image slideshows without any coding knowledge.
  • Responsive Design
    This plugin ensures that all image sliders are fully responsive, providing an optimal viewing experience across all devices, including desktops, tablets, and smartphones.
  • Customizability
    The plugin offers various customization options, enabling users to personalize their sliders with different effects, transitions, and styles to match their website's aesthetic.
  • SEO Optimization
    Ultimate Responsive Image Slider includes SEO-friendly features, helping ensure that image sliders do not adversely affect website performance and search engine rankings.
  • Regular Updates
    The developers provide regular updates, which can include new features, improvements, and security patches to ensure the plugin remains effective and secure.

Possible disadvantages of Ultimate Responsive Image Slider

  • Limited Advanced Features
    While the plugin offers a range of basic features, some users may find it lacks more advanced functionalities available in premium or more complex slider plugins.
  • Potential Conflicts
    As with many WordPress plugins, there is a risk of conflicts with other plugins or themes, which may require troubleshooting to resolve compatibility issues.
  • Dependency on Plugin Maintenance
    The effectiveness and security of the image slider depend on the continued support and maintenance by the developers, which may be a concern if the plugin becomes outdated.
  • Learning Curve for Beginners
    Although user-friendly, some beginners might still face a learning curve in understanding all features and settings available in the plugin.

Possible disadvantages of CommitCat

  • Limited Feature Set
    Compared to more established Git clients like GitKraken, Sourcetree, or Fork, CommitCat may lack advanced features such as built-in merge conflict resolution tools, advanced branch visualization, or deep integration with CI/CD pipelines.
  • Small Community and Ecosystem
    As a lesser-known tool, CommitCat has a smaller user community, which means fewer tutorials, community-driven plugins, and peer support compared to mainstream Git clients.
  • Limited Visibility and Traction
    CommitCat appears to have limited online presence and user reviews, making it difficult for potential users to assess its reliability, maturity, and long-term viability before adopting it.
  • Uncertain Development Activity
    It is unclear how actively CommitCat is being maintained and developed. A tool with infrequent updates may fall behind in compatibility with newer Git features or operating system updates.
  • Lack of Enterprise Features
    CommitCat may not offer enterprise-grade features such as team collaboration tools, access control integrations, or support for large-scale repository management that organizations often require.
